Ammonia-Totally free H2o— Functionally, this h2o need to have a negligible ammonia focus in order to avoid interference in tests delicate to ammonia. It's been equated with Significant Purity H2o that has a considerably tighter Stage one conductivity specification than Purified H2o due to latter's allowance for a negligible amount of ammonium among other ions. Nevertheless, If your consumer's Purified Water have been filtered and satisfied or exceeded the conductivity specifications of Substantial Purity Drinking water, it might consist of negligible ammonia or other ions and could be Employed in lieu of Substantial Purity Water. Carbon Dioxide-Free of charge Drinking water— The introductory percentage of the Reagents, Indicators, and Remedies part defines this h2o as Purified Drinking water that has been vigorously boiled for at least 5 minutes, then cooled and protected from absorption of atmospheric carbon dioxide. As the absorption of carbon dioxide has a tendency to drive down the water pH, many of the employs of Carbon Dioxide-Totally free Drinking water are either associated as being a solvent in pH-relevant or pH- delicate determinations or for a solvent in carbonate-delicate reagents or determinations. A further use of the h2o is for specified optical rotation and color and clarity of Alternative tests. While it is possible this h2o is indicated for these tests just because of its purity, It is usually achievable that the pH results of carbon dioxide made up of drinking water could interfere with the final results of such tests. A 3rd plausible rationale this drinking water is indicated is outgassing air bubbles could possibly interfere with these photometric-kind tests. The boiled drinking water preparation approach will also drastically minimized the concentrations of a number of other dissolved gases coupled with carbon dioxide. For that reason, in several of the programs for Carbon Dioxide-Absolutely free Water, it may be the inadvertent deaeration effect that actually renders this h2o suited.

Packaged waters current a specific Predicament relative to your attributes of conductivity and TOC. The package alone is definitely the source of chemicals (inorganics and organics) that leach eventually to the water and website can easily be detected. The irony of natural leaching from plastic packaging is the fact when the Oxidizable substances test was the only “organic contaminant” test for both equally bulk and packaged waters, that test's insensitivity to Individuals organic leachables rendered their presence in packaged drinking water at higher concentrations (often times the TOC specification for bulk water) just about undetectable.

Inspect the autoclaves useful for the sterilization of media. Autoclaves might lack a chance to displace steam with sterile filtered air. For sealed bottles of media, This could not present a problem. Nonetheless, for non-sealed bottles or flasks of media, non-sterile air has led on the contamination of media. Moreover, autoclaving a lot less than the expected time can even allow media associated contaminants to grow and cause a false positive final result. These difficulties may very well be much more common in laboratories with a heavy workload.
